About Iain
Iain started his Audio and Video career back in Secondary School, becoming the school’s Chief Audio and Video editor in 2001. During this period he did multiple assignments for his school, such as presentations for parents evenings, recording concerts, and touring Europe with the school band.
In 2004 gaming started to take off, he joined his first Enemy Territory clan [LTC] as Mowgli, from there in 2005 he moved into xytogen as a manager, and helped with sponsorship and fundraising for the 48 hour Enemy Territory marathon, as well as assiting in the Web Development team for a period.
After xytogen disbanding Iain joined uQ.Gaming just before their ET Eurocup victory as a Web Technician. From there Iain got involved with managing once again and was often seen playing as a last ditch backup for the CS:S squad.
Just before i28 in 2006 Iain decided to leave uQ with 2 of their squads and set up team ROCK with long term clan mate genGz, he went to i28 with team ROCK’s BattleField 2 and Call of Duty 2 teams. Team ROCK CoD2 managed to get their hands on five Core2Duo laptops before they were released, and helped demonstrate their capabilities alongside the demos in the ROCK bus. After i28 Iain decided to call it a day with team ROCK, and moved on to work with Multiplay as a Video Editor for i29.
In March 2007, Iain joined up with QuadV from his role as a key member of Multiplay's coverage team, and took on the role of Lead Video Editor and Audio Engineer.
